Prof. Dr. Jana Zaumseil is awarded the Alfried-Krupp Sponsorship Award 2010

Prof. Dr. Jana Zaumseil, professor of nanoelectronics at the Engineering of Advanced Materials (EAM) Cluster of Excellence at the Friedrich-Alexander University of Erlangen-Nuremberg (FAU), received the 2010 sponsorship award for young university lecturers from the Alfried Krupp von Bohlen und Halbach Foundation. The award entails funding totalling 1 million euros over a period of five years.

“We are delighted with Prof. Zaumseil’s award”, said Prof. Wolfgang Peukert, the coordinator of the Cluster of Excellence. “The sponsorship is proof that, within the framework of the Cluster, we are succeeding in attracting the best researchers to Erlangen. Her expertise and the additional funding from the sponsorship award will generate added impetus for nanoelectronics research at FAU in the future.” During her PhD Prof. Zaumseil worked on topical areas in the field of organic electronics. Her work in Erlangen is primarily concerned with the synthesis of and research into innovative nanomaterials, which depending on their size can only absorb and emit light of specific wavelengths. The aim is to understand how these processes can be influenced and controlled so that they can be used for optoelectronic components.

Prof. Dr. Jana Zaumseil

Born in Jena in 1977, Jana Zaumseil studied at the University of Leipzig and graduated in chemistry. After a year-long research internship at the renowned Bell Laboratories in Murray Hill (USA) she went on to do her PhD in Cambridge (UK). She then spent two years researching at the Center for Nanoscale Materials at the Argonne National Laboratory (USA). In October 2009, Jana Zaumseil was appointed W2 Professor for Nanoelectronics in the Cluster of Excellence. This appointment was connected to the Cluster’s “EAM Award” which was also endowed with 750,000 euros. Even as a student she received numerous awards and scholarships in Germany, England and the USA.
